This spot features a bright, lively atmosphere with a fabulous heated outdoor patio and a dog-friendly play area, making it ideal for families. The staff is knowledgeable about celiac disease and gluten-free handling procedures, ensuring a safe and welcoming environment for gluten-free diners.

Love Brixx. Since my discovery in 2023, I've been 6 times when I've been around the Raleigh area. I have Celiac, and they have 2 types or GF crust. I have not had a problem. The servers are well educated and helpful in ordering. The price is a lot for the size, and until there is a big shake up in the restaurant industry, as a gluten-free diner, we know we pay extra to stay safe. The wings go well with the pizza, too.

This spot offers a dedicated gluten-free fryer ensuring safe fry options and gluten-free buns for those with dietary needs. The relaxed atmosphere and attentive service create a welcoming environment for gluten-free diners seeking flavorful, worry-free meals.

GREAT gluten free/gluten friendly options! I had Sheperd’s pie, potato skins, and the chocolate cake (all gluten free/friendly) and had no reaction. I’m not super sensitive like some people, but I do usually react to cross-contamination. Great vibe and service! Totally recommend for any occasion
